Step-by-Step Guide to Repairing Bi-Fold Doors

The process of repairing bi-fold doors can differ depending on the specific problem at hand. However, the following general steps can guide you through most repairs.

1. Recognize the Problem

Before you rush into repairing, it's crucial to determine the issue accurately. Is it alignment, sticking, or harmed panels? Observing the door throughout operation can help figure out the needed repairs.

2. Collect Your Tools and Materials

Once you've determined the issue, assemble all the tools and materials noted above to ensure you are gotten ready for the repair.

3. Change the Alignment

The primary step in most repairs is to ensure the door is appropriately lined up.

  • Examine Level: Use a level to examine whether doors are hanging straight.
  • Adjust Track or Rollers: Using a screwdriver, change the roller height on both sides up until the door is level and fits correctly in the track.

4. Clean the Tracks

Dirt and debris can cause doors to stick. Cleaning the track is often a simple solution.

  • Elimination of Debris: Clear any dirt, leaves, or particles obstructing the track.
  • Oil Tracks: Apply silicone lubricant to smooth operation.

5. Replace Faulty Rollers

If the doors continue to misalign or stick after cleaning, the rollers may need replacement.

  • Eliminate Door Panels: Lift the doors out of the track.
  • Set Up New Rollers: Replace old rollers with brand-new ones, ensuring they fit appropriately before re-installing.

6. Repair or Replace Glass Panels

If there are fractures or breaks in the glass:

  • Remove Panels: Carefully separate the broken panel.
  • Install New Glass: Secure the new glass in place, using silicone sealant for weatherproofing.

7. Examine and Replace Hardware

Inspect all hardware components such as screws, hinges, and locks:

  • Tighten Any Loose Parts: Ensure all screws are tight and safe and secure.
  • Replace What's Necessary: If hardware is used or harmed, replace as required.

8. Seal Gaps

To address drafts:

  • Install or Replace Weather Stripping: This can significantly improve insulation and energy efficiency.

9. Check the Doors

Lastly, as soon as all repairs are done, evaluate the doors multiple times to ensure that they are working correctly.

Maintenance Tips for Bi-Fold Doors

To avoid future problems and extend the lifespan of your bi-fold doors, think about these maintenance tips:

  1. Regular Cleaning: Keep tracks and rollers complimentary from dirt and particles.
  2. Lubrication: Periodically lubricate the tracks and rollers to guarantee smooth operation.
  3. Weather Check: Inspect weather condition stripping yearly and replace if needed.
  4. Tighten up Hardware: Check screws and bolts for tightness and security frequently.
  5. Professional Inspection: Consider having a professional inspection every few years.

F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TION

What can I do if my bi-fold door keeps sticking?

Routine cleaning and lubrication might resolve the problem. If the issue persists, inspect for positioning and replace malfunctioning rollers.

How can I tell if my bi-fold door tracks are damaged?

Examine the tracks for bends or breaks, and run your hand along them to recognize rough spots. website broken track may need replacement.

Should I replace the glass myself?

If you're comfortable with tools and have previous experience, you can replace the glass yourself. Nevertheless, for larger panels or if not sure, it's best to employ a professional.

How frequently should I carry out maintenance on my bi-fold doors?

A regular maintenance check every six months is a good idea, with more regular examinations if you reside in a high-traffic area or experience severe weather.

Can a DIY repair save money?

Yes, numerous small repairs can be carried out by property owners, saving money on labor expenses. Nevertheless, for intricate problems or safety issues, working with a professional is suggested.
